Re: Transmission oil capacity
« Reply #4 on: September 20, 2014, 09:01:47 AM »


Note that Harley hedges a bit and says oil capacity "is approximately 32 fluid ounces or 0.95 liters".  It's like the motor oil or primary, it all depends on how well you drained the old stuff first, and it's always best to double check with the dipstick.  Fortunately on the trans the only damage from overfilling I'm aware of might be blowing some lube out the vent tube all over your shiny ride and possibly the rear tire.
